A node named 'Tomato' gets assigned to the term 'Vegetable' in the 'Food' vocabulary. When 'Tomato' gets reassigned to 'Fruit', also in the 'Food' vocablulary, the node properly gets assigned to the 'Fruit' term, however, it still belongs to the 'Vegetable' term, too. In other words, the 'Tomato' node now belongs to the 'Vegetable' and 'Fruit' terms simultaneously.
